Abstract

The utility model relates to the technical field of baby products, and aims to provide a baby cradle, which comprises a mounting rack and a cradle; the two sides of the mounting rack are both provided with U-shaped supports, and each support comprises two support legs and a bottom rod connected between the two support legs; the bottom rod is in an arc shape with the middle part bent downwards; the bottom rod is provided with a fixing device; the fixing device comprises two fixing pieces hinged to two ends of the bottom rod respectively; the fixing piece can rotate downwards until the level of the lower end of the fixing piece is lower than the lowest position of the bottom rod. The bottom rod with the arc-shaped bottom is utilized, so that the bracket can drive the mounting frame and the cradle to shake back and forth along the arc shape, and a baby can fall asleep conveniently; when the cradle does not need to be shaken, the two fixing pieces at the two ends of the bottom rod are downwards rotated, so that the lower ends of the fixing pieces are downwards supported on the ground, the two ends of the bottom rod are limited, the support cannot shake, the safety of the cradle is improved, and a baby is prevented from falling out of the cradle.

Description

Baby cradle
Technical Field
The utility model relates to a articles for babies technical field, in particular to baby's shaking table.
Background
The cradle is a special appliance for babies in families, and aims to create moderate shaking in the mother abdomen, so that the baby has comfortable sensation and safe feeling, and the baby can fall asleep easily.
At present, a chinese patent document with an authorization publication number of CN208435096U in the prior art discloses a portable baby cradle, which comprises a tumbler cradle bottom shell and an arc-shaped extension light screen, wherein one end of the tumbler cradle bottom shell is provided with a cradle head end plate, and the other end is provided with a cradle tail end plate; the lower end of the arc-shaped extension shading plate is connected to the outer side of the cradle head end plate, the upper end of the arc-shaped extension shading plate is connected with a suspension plate, and a latex mattress is arranged in the center of the inner part of the bottom shell of the tumbler cradle; the bottom shell of the tumbler cradle refers to the principle of a tumbler, a baby is placed on the latex bed cushion in the cradle, and the cradle is pushed to shake, so that the baby can be conveniently put to sleep.
However, in the daytime, the bottom case of the tumbler cradle cannot be completely fixed, if the baby is disorderly moved, the bottom case of the tumbler cradle is easy to shake, if the baby is lying on the edge of the bottom case of the tumbler cradle, even the bottom case of the tumbler cradle is inclined, so that the baby turns outwards, and the safety threat is caused.
SUMMERY OF THE UTILITY MODEL
The utility model aims at providing a cradle, to the two kinds of circumstances that the baby sleeps and is awake, have can rock and two kinds of using-way of fixed motionless.
The above technical purpose of the present invention can be achieved by the following technical solutions:
a cradle comprises a frame-shaped mounting rack, wherein a cradle is arranged at the center of the mounting rack; the two sides of the mounting rack are both provided with U-shaped brackets, and the brackets on the two sides are arranged oppositely; the support comprises two support legs and a bottom rod, wherein two ends of the bottom rod are respectively connected with the lower ends of the two support legs; the bottom rod is in an arc shape with the middle part bent downwards; the bottom rod is provided with a fixing device for stabilizing the bottom rod so that the bottom rod cannot shake; the fixing device comprises two fixing pieces which are respectively connected to two ends of the bottom rod in a rotating manner; the fixing piece can rotate downwards until the level of the lower end of the fixing piece is lower than the lowest position of the bottom rod.
By adopting the technical scheme, the bottom rod with the arc-shaped bottom is utilized, so that the bracket can drive the mounting frame and the cradle to shake back and forth along the arc shape, and a baby can be conveniently put asleep; when the cradle does not need to be shaken, the two fixing pieces at the two ends of the bottom rod are rotated downwards, so that the lower ends of the fixing pieces are supported on the ground downwards, the two ends of the bottom rod are limited, the bracket cannot shake, the safety of the cradle is improved, and the baby is prevented from falling out of the cradle; when the cradle is to be shaken, the fixing piece is rotated towards the bottom rod again.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
The embodiment discloses a cradle, as shown in fig. 1 and 2, comprising a mounting rack 1 in a rectangular frame shape, wherein the mounting rack 1 is formed by connecting four cross bars 11 end to end; hang in the center department of mounting bracket 1 and be equipped with cradle 2, cradle 2 is by the bottom pad portion 22 of rectangle, connect the side wall portion 21 on bottom pad portion 22 border all around and constitute, the side wall portion 21 of cloth material upwards extends by the border of bottom pad portion 22, pass from the inboard of mounting bracket 1 after again from the outside side down of horizontal pole 11 top, press from both sides horizontal pole 11 in the side wall portion 21 after turning over, finally fix through the magic subsides (not shown in the figure) that set up on side wall portion 21, thereby make cradle 2 install on mounting bracket 1.
As shown in fig. 1 and 2, a U-shaped bracket 3 is respectively installed on the left side and the right side of the mounting rack 1; the support 3 is formed by bending a hollow metal pipe twice, and comprises two support legs 31 and a bottom rod 32, wherein the two support legs 31 are respectively fixed at the front end and the rear end of the mounting frame 1 through two connecting pieces 5 made of plastic materials; the bottom rod 32 is arc-shaped with the middle part bent downwards, and the bracket 3 can drive the mounting rack 1 and the cradle 2 to shake back and forth along the arc under the action of external force, so that the baby can fall asleep conveniently.
As shown in fig. 3, the connecting member 5 includes a clamping portion 51 extending along the length direction of the front and rear crossbars 11, and a sleeve portion 52 integrally formed at the lower end of the clamping portion 51; the clamping part 51 is integrally formed with a clamping groove 511 which is upwardly clamped on the mounting frame 1, so that the section of the clamping part 51 is U-shaped, and the inner diameter of the U-shaped bottom is equal to the diameter of the cross rod 11. The side of the cross bar 11 is provided with a positioning hole 12 corresponding to the position of the connecting member 5, the clamping portion 51 is provided with a corresponding through hole 513, and a positioning nail 512 penetrates through the positioning hole 12 and the through hole 513 to realize the positioning and fixing between the connecting member 5 and the cross bar 11.
As shown in fig. 2 and 3, the insertion portion 52 is hollow and tubular, and has a through hole 521 at an end thereof for inserting the upper end of the leg 31 and fitting the upper end of the leg in an interference fit; and the penetrating parts 52 of the two connecting pieces 5 on the same cross bar 11 extend obliquely downwards towards the direction of relative distance respectively, so that the support legs 31 of the two supports 3 extend obliquely downwards towards the two sides respectively, the mounting rack 1 is supported by obliquely upwards supporting force from the two sides to the middle, and the stability of the mounting rack 1 when being subjected to force in the left and right directions is improved.
As shown in fig. 1 and 3, two operation holes 211 for the connecting piece 5 to pass through and be mounted on the cross bar 11 are respectively formed at the front end and the rear end of the mounting frame 1 on the side wall portion 21. Before the cradle 2 is installed, the four connecting pieces 5 are installed on the installation frame 1, then the side wall parts 21 are turned over and fixed, so that the connecting pieces 5 penetrate through the operation holes 211, then the supporting feet 31 are inserted into the through holes 521 of the sleeve penetrating parts 52, at the moment, the connecting pieces 5 are limited by the supporting feet 31 and cannot penetrate through the operation holes 211 again, and therefore the side wall parts 21 are locked, and when the magic tapes on the side wall parts 21 lose the fixing effect, the side wall parts 21 can be turned back to cause the cradle 2 to fall.
As shown in fig. 1 and 4, the bottom rod 32 is provided with a fixing device 4 for stabilizing the bottom rod 32 so that the bottom rod cannot shake, and the fixing device 4 includes two fixing members 41 respectively hinged to two ends of the bottom rod 32 and a filler strip 42 fixedly connected between the two fixing members 41 at the bottom of the bottom rod 32. The fixing member 41 is integrally formed with a receiving groove 412 which is through towards both ends, the inner wall of the receiving groove 412 and the outer wall of the bottom bar 32 are mutually attached, so that the section of the fixing member 41 along the length direction of the bottom bar 32 is U-shaped, and the opening at the upper end of the U-shape is slightly smaller than the diameter of the bottom bar 32; the ends of the two fixing pieces 41, which are relatively far away from each other, are respectively provided with a pin shaft 411 which penetrates through the bottom rod 32, and the fixing pieces 41 are hinged with the bottom rod 32 through the pin shafts 411; the receding groove 413 is integrally formed at one end of the fixing element 41 close to the pin 411 and at a side away from the opening of the receiving groove 412.
When the cradle 2 is not required to be shaken, the two fixing members 41 are rotated by an angle α (α is greater than 90 degrees, and can be 100 degrees or 120 degrees) towards the lower sides, so that the inner wall of the abdicating groove 413 is abutted against the outer wall of the bottom rod 32, the fixing members 41 cannot rotate continuously, the horizontal height of the lower end of the fixing members 41 is lower than the lowest position of the bottom rod 32, the two ends of the bottom rod 32 can be limited, the support 3 can be stably placed on the ground, the safety of the cradle 2 is improved, the baby is prevented from falling out of the cradle 2, the support 3 is supported by the supporting force which is inclined upwards from the middle of the two ends of the bottom, the support 3 can be kept stable when the support is subjected to the force in the front-back direction, the fixing members 41 are subjected to the gravity, the abdicating groove 413 can be tightly attached to the bottom rod 32, the stability of the support 3 is further enhanced, when the cradle 2 is required to be shaken, the fixing members 41 are only required to be rotated towards the bottom rod 32, the bottom rod 32 is placed in the receding groove 412, and the space below the fixing members 41 is prevented from being occupied by the bottom rod 32, and the shaking of the fixing.
As shown in fig. 1 and 4, the filler strip 42 is made of rubber, the filler strip 42 extends along the length direction of the bottom rod 32, and the cross section thereof is in a convex shape, and the maximum thickness in the direction of the bottom rod 32 is equal to the thickness between the inner bottom wall of the accommodating groove 412 and the outer bottom wall of the fixing member 41. The pad strip 42 is used for replacing the bottom rod 32 to be in contact with the ground, and the rubber material enables the support 3 to be more stable in the shaking process, so that the baby is prevented from feeling uncomfortable; when the convex pad strip 42 is obliquely arranged on the support 3, a groove can be formed between the middle bulge and the side edge, and when the groove is in contact with the ground, the contact area between the groove and the ground can be increased by utilizing the soft property of the pad strip 42, so that the function of increasing friction force is achieved; and the padding strip 42 heightens the distance between the bottom rod 32 and the ground, so that the fixing member 41 is engaged with the bottom wall of the padding strip 42, and when the shaking amplitude of the bracket 3 is large, the fixing member 41 can be smoothly contacted with the ground.
